In high schools A and B, the proportion of teenagers smoking has been estimated to be .20. The same antismoking educational program will be used again in high school A but a new program is planned for high school B. There is concern whether the new program will be better or worse than the old one or if the results will be about the same.

A study is planned to compare the proportion smoking in the two high schools in June after the programs have been run. The investigators want to take an adequate sample of students and ask them questions concerning their smoking.

They want to make sure that their sample size is large enough so they can detect a difference of .10 in the proportion smoking with α = .05 and β = .10. What size sample should they take in each high school?
